小程序链接变网站
随着移动互联网的普及和发展,小程序成为越来越多企业和个人选择的一种移动应用开发方式。小程序的优势在于无需下载安装、占用空间小、开发成本低、使用方便等等。但是,相比于网站,小程序的推广和传播相对来说还不够便捷和广泛。因此,将小程序链接变成网站链接成为了一种有意义的尝试。一、小程序链接变网站的原理小程序...
2023-10-12 围观 : 17次
小程序是一种轻量级的应用程序,它们可以在微信、支付宝等各种平台上运行。虽然小程序非常便捷,但是在某些情况下,将小程序打包成APK文件也是非常有必要的。例如,如果您想在没有网络连接的情况下使用小程序,或者如果您想在其他平台上使用小程序,那么将小程序打包成APK文件就是一个不错的选择。
小程序打包成APK文件的原理
小程序打包成APK文件的原理是将小程序的代码和资源文件打包成一个APK文件,然后在Android系统上运行。这个过程需要使用一些工具和技术,例如Android Studio和微信开发者工具。
具体来说,以下是打包小程序成APK文件的大致步骤:
1. 下载Android Studio和微信开发者工具
Android Studio是谷歌的官方开发工具,它可以用来创建和打包APK文件。微信开发者工具是微信官方提供的开发工具,它可以用来创建和调试小程序。
2. 创建一个新的Android项目
在Android Studio中创建一个新的Android项目。在创建项目时,您需要选择一个项目名称和包名。这个包名必须与您的小程序包名相同。
3. 将小程序代码和资源文件导入到项目中
将您的小程序代码和资源文件导入到Android Studio项目中。这可以通过将小程序代码复制到项目的src/main/assets文件夹中来完成。
4. 配置项目的构建文件
在项目的build.gradle文件中配置项目的构建文件。这个文件包含了项目的构建信息,例如使用的库和依赖项。
5. 打包APK文件
使用Android Studio的构建工具打包APK文件。这个过程会将小程序代码和资源文件打包成一个APK文件。
6. 安装和运行APK文件
将APK文件安装到Android设备上,并运行它。您可以使用任何支持Android系统的设备来运行APK文件。
小程序打包成APK文件的详细介绍
下面是将小程序打包成APK文件的详细步骤:
1. 下载Android Studio和微信开发者工具
首先,您需要下载Android Studio和微信开发者工具。Android Studio可以从谷歌官方网站上下载,而微信开发者工具可以从微信官方网站上下载。安装这些工具后,您就可以开始将小程序打包成APK文件了。
2. 创建一个新的Android项目
在Android Studio中创建一个新的Android项目。在创建项目时,您需要选择一个项目名称和包名。您可以选择任何您喜欢的项目名称,但是包名必须与您的小程序包名相同。例如,如果您的小程序包名为com.example.myapp,那么您的Android项目包名也必须为com.example.myapp。
3. 将小程序代码和资源文件导入到项目中
将您的小程序代码和资源文件导入到Android Studio项目中。这可以通过将小程序代码复制到项目的src/main/assets文件夹中来完成。如果您的小程序包含多个页面或组件,那么您需要将所有的代码和资源文件都复制到这个文件夹中。
4. 配置项目的构建文件
在项目的build.gradle文件中配置项目的构建文件。这个文件包含了项目的构建信息,例如使用的库和依赖项。您需要在这个文件中添加以下代码:
```gradle
android {
compileSdkVersion 28
defaultConfig {
applicationId "com.example.myapp"
minSdkVersion 19
targetSdkVersion 28
versionCode 1
versionName "1.0"
multiDexEnabled true
test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
}
buildTypes {
release {
minifyEnabled false
pro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
}
}
```
其中,applicationId必须与您的小程序包名相同。这个代码还指定了项目的SDK版本、最小SDK版本、目标SDK版本、版本号和版本名称。
5. 打包APK文件
使用Android Studio的构建工具打包APK文件。这个过程会将小程序代码和资源文件打包成一个APK文件。要打包APK文件,请按照以下步骤操作:
- 在Android Studio中打开项目。
- 单击“Build”菜单,然后单击“Generate Signed Bundle/APK”。
- 在“Generate Signed Bundle/APK”对话框中,选择“APK”选项,然后单击“Next”。
- 在“Select Module”对话框中,选择您的项目模块,然后单击“Next”。
- 在“Configure APK”对话框中,选择“release”选项,然后单击“Next”。
- 在“Sign APK”对话框中,选择您的密钥库文件和密码,然后单击“Next”。
- 在“Verify APK”对话框中,单击“Finish”。
打包APK文件可能需要一些时间,具体取决于您的小程序大小和您的计算机性能。
6. 安装和运行APK文件
将APK文件安装到Android设备上,并运行它。您可以使用任何支持Android系统的设备来运行APK文件。要安装和运行APK文件,请按照以下步骤操作:
- 将APK文件复制到Android设备上。
- 在Android设备上启用“安装未知来源应用程序”选项。
- 使用任何文件管理器应用程序浏览到APK文件,然后单击它。
- 在“安装”对话框中,单击“安装”按钮。
- 等待安装完成,然后在Android设备上启动您的小程序。
注意事项
将小程序打包成APK文件可能会遇到一些问题。以下是一些常见的问题和解决方法:
1. 包名冲突
如果您的小程序包名与其他应用程序包名冲突,那么您可能无法将小程序打包成APK文件。要解决这个问题,请将小程序包名更改为其他唯一的名称。
2. 图片资源丢失
如果您的小程序包含大量图片资源,那么在打包APK文件时可能会出现一些问题。例如,一些图片可能会丢失或损坏。要解决这个问题,请确保将所有图片资源复制到Android Studio项目中,并且路径正确。
3. 缺少库或依赖项
如果您的小程序使用了某些库或依赖项,那么在打包APK文件时可能会出现一些问题。例如,某些库可能会与Android系统库冲突。要解决这个问题,请确保在项目的build.gradle文件中正确配置库和依赖项。
总结
将小程序打包成APK文件是一个非常有用的技能,它可以让您在没有网络连接的情况下使用小程序,或在其他平台上使用小程序。虽然这个过程可能有些复杂,但是只要您按照以上步骤操作,就可以将小程序打包成APK文件。
随着移动互联网的普及和发展,小程序成为越来越多企业和个人选择的一种移动应用开发方式。小程序的优势在于无需下载安装、占用空间小、开发成本低、使用方便等等。但是,相比于网站,小程序的推广和传播相对来说还不够便捷和广泛。因此,将小程序链接变成网站链接成为了一种有意义的尝试。一、小程序链接变网站的原理小程序...
微信小程序是一种轻量级的应用程序,用户可在微信App内直接使用,不需要下载安装,具有开发成本低、运行效率高的特点,已成为企业以及开发者致力于移动端应用开发的重要选择之一。那么,微信小程序的开发工具是怎样进行使用的呢?下面将详细介绍微信小程序使用开发工具的原理。1. 开发环境准备首先,需要准备开发环境...
微信小程序基于微信10亿的用户,再加上微信公众号和微信朋友圈引流。自带天然的流量优势。随着微信小程序新技术不断升级,微信小程序已经成为如今新零售行业的转型的场务。很多新零售行业商家抓住这个转型的机会,同时也享受到微信小程序带来的红利,一波接着一波。如果您想抓住这波红利,动动手,开通【木鱼小铺】微信小...
现在小程序的运用非常的广泛,频繁的出现在我们朋友圈中。关于小程序运营推广成为很多运营者关注的焦点。今天通过几张思维导图,带大家一起来了解一下小程序运营推广?一、线上推广方式:1.附近的小程序入口附近小程序基于LBS的门店位置的推广,会自然带来访问量,为门店带来有效客户。2.微信搜索进入小程序可以在...
微信小程序是一种在微信平台上运行的应用程序,它可以直接从微信中打开,无需下载安装。与传统的应用程序不同,微信小程序采用了一种“轻应用”的形式,它的体积更小,功能更简单,但同时也更易于开发和使用。微信小程序可以嵌入到网页中,使得用户可以直接在网页上进行操作,无需跳转到微信中。微信小程序嵌入网页的原理很...